            fuser acum days all supplies are good for 740 days(sharp spec) sharp recommends after 2 years or xxxxxx copies to replace item.

            total bw and total color are just that, total output for color and bw. maint all is page count since last maint (includes bw and color count) at 155000 you are overdue or count was not reset. Sharp default maint count all is 100k. you are also overdue on color, default is 60k. black dev and drum pm are at 100k. maint all most times won't sync up with the black dev and drum pm. your dev and drum counts are in sim 22 also.

            Also have your local Sharp tech check out the copier if you are not seeing the maint. required message on the display, settings have been changed or turned off.

                500 is the days since component was replaced.
                B/W total output is total output and same goes with color.
                Maintenance All, I do not pay to much attention to because I clear it at every call and something maybe needed before the maintenance all light comes up.
                I pay attention to the individual counters.
                The days, I may look at if the component is showing wear, machine has been sitting in warehouse or I have some CQ issues that seems unexplained. If the counter says 740/740, chances are, I will fight with machine less and just order necessary PM parts.
